95 Points Robert Parker
The newest release, the 2016 Shiraz-Viognier displays trademark florals, spices and red fruit. It's voluminous without being weighty, fruity and savory, with licorice, pepper and meaty notes on the long, silky finish. Fans of the style will want to grab extra bottles of this one, as it should drink well for up to two decades.
Source: Robert Parker (Robert Parker Wine Advocate) by Joe Czerwinski. January, 2018
98 Points James Halliday
The perfumed, spicy bouquet with red flowers and fruits doesn't prepare you for the intensity and piercing length of its beautifully balanced medium-bodied palate. This is a truly glorious wine that draws you back again and again to explore the wealth of red fruit flavours, and the majesty of its texture and structure. Drink to 2041.
James Halliday. June, 2023
